Output 7b58b70a7ef2644a29119ad4f19ee56c3e690a3f9caaaaf0bfa177188d203e6c:114

value
2054720
script pubkey
OP_0 OP_PUSHBYTES_20 abe56adc412f6ffeeb501899e2ccf5f0c49e02b6
address
bc1q40jk4hzp9ahla66srzv79n847rzfuq4kkauz9h
transaction
7b58b70a7ef2644a29119ad4f19ee56c3e690a3f9caaaaf0bfa177188d203e6c